Mercury, Latin Mercurius, in Roman religion, god of shopkeepers and merchants, travelers and transporters of goods, and thieves and tricksters. He is commonly identified with the Greek Hermes, the fleet-footed messenger of the gods.

The messenger of the gods in Greek mythology was Hermes. He was the son of Zeus and Maia and was the fastest of the gods. He was often sent to deliver messages from the gods to mortals, and was also responsible for guiding souls to the Underworld.

Hermes was the messenger of the gods in Greek mythology. He was known for his ability to move quickly and his cunning nature. He was often depicted wearing winged sandals and a winged hat.
